About Great Lakes Insurance SE:

As a specialty provider of primary insurance services in the UK, Great Lakes London Branch ("GLLB") is a significant part of Great Lakes Insurance SE in Munich. Our business model focuses on opportunities linked to reinsurance and innovation, as part of the Munich Re Group. We operate from Munich and branch offices in the UK, Ireland, Switzerland, Italy, and Australia.

About the role:

The primary goal is to lead a team to establish and maintain a robust oversight framework for Third-Party Administrators (TPAs) in the UK, ensuring compliance with internal guidelines, international standards, and regulatory requirements, with a focus on delivering Good Customer Outcomes. This role is part of the UK Claims Leadership Team, overseeing TPA operational performance and compliance.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Develop and enhance claims processes, work instructions, reporting, and governance strategies to oversee TPAs and reduce reputational and conduct risks.
  • Identify operational improvement opportunities in TPA management and champion solutions in collaboration with other claims teams and business functions.
  • Lead regulatory and compliance projects related to TPA oversight and manage the GLISE Claims Change and Process Improvement portfolio.
  • Manage projects according to Change Management Framework principles, focusing on TPA compliance and performance.
  • Create internal reporting frameworks to assist Claims Managers in TPA performance oversight.
  • Line manage a team of Claims reporting and MI specialists, utilizing Group Analyst Specialists for TPA oversight initiatives.
  • Maintain a consistent reporting framework and IT tools for management and Board monitoring of TPA performance.
  • Oversee the delegation of claims authority to TPAs, ensuring high standards of claim performance and service in line with company and regulatory standards.

This role is crucial in ensuring UK TPAs operate compliantly and efficiently, supporting claims management excellence and customer outcomes while minimizing risks.
